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Big-eared Hopping Mouse | Panama ghost cat shark |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Chondrichthyes (Cartilaginous Fish)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Carcharhiniformes (Ground Sharks) |
| Family | Muridae (Mice & Rats) | Scyliorhinidae |
| Genus | Notomys | Apristurus |
| Species | Notomys macrotis | Apristurus stenseni |
Evolutionary Relationship
Big-eared Hopping Mouse and Panama ghost cat shark share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
